The LINQ Promenade is open to the public 24/7, but shop and restaurant hours vary (generally from 11:00 AM to 11:00 PM). Admission is free, and it is easily accessed from the Las Vegas Strip. The High Roller operates from 11:30 AM to 2:00 AM. Check updated hours on the official website.
Access to the promenade is completely free, but attractions such as the High Roller (the giant observation wheel) require a ticket: from $25 for daytime and $37 for nighttime. You can book online with a discount on the official page.
We recommend 1–2 hours to stroll around, browse themed shops, and grab something to eat or drink. If you include the High Roller (a 30-minute rotation), add another 30–45 minutes. It is ideal for short visits between other plans on the Strip.
Opened in 2014, it was part of the modernization of the Strip to attract a younger crowd with dynamic shops such as the first In-N-Out Burger in the heart of the area and new digital entertainment, marking the transition toward more immersive experiences.
Avoid July and August because of the extreme heat (+40°C / 104°F). October through April is ideal. The best time of day is after sunset to enjoy the lights of the Strip and the lively atmosphere. The High Roller offers spectacular views 1 hour before sunset.

1) Wear comfortable shoes (cobblestone pavement) 2) Stay hydrated (water bottles $5+) 3) Take advantage of Happy Hours (4:00 PM–6:00 PM) 4) Park for free with a validated ticket from a participating business 5) Avoid Friday and Saturday nights because of crowds.
